5 Times Charles Barkley and Shaquille O'Neal had Heated Fights on Inside the NBA

There was always a tough competition between Charles Barkley and Shaquille O'Neal on the NBA court that sometimes ended in a fight. Aside from the court, they had a friendly and understanding relationship with each other. At the moment, both former players are analysts in the Inside the NBA. There are times when they fight over various issues. So here are 5 times Shaquille O'Neal and Charles Barkley got into heated arguments on Inside the NBA

Clash Over Klay Thompson

“When you’re a role player you just have to adjust,” said Shaq. “When Klay wasn’t there, those guys got more freedom. Now that he’s back, you gotta readjust.” Chuck had none of it, interrupting him by saying, “It’s not that simple Shaq.” And the 15-time All-star hit back, claiming, “It’s very simple. I played, let me finish, I didn’t interrupt you.”
